Fold one strip in half wrong side (WS) together, so the long edges meet, and press with a hot iron. Unfold the strip and now fold both long edges to meet the centre crease you have just made. WebHow to make a folded star Cut a square base from fabric; base should be slightly larger than desired finished size. Pencil a horizontal and vertical line and 2 diagonals on base to indicate centre of square and placement of … WebNov 6, 2024 · Press the fabric strips well with spray starch, let it dry, and press well.
